The Myklashevskyi Estate, an architectural landmark, was damaged by a Russian airstrike in the village of Bilenke, Zaporizhzhia.

The historic 19th-century mansion, which belonged to the Cossack elite family Myklashevskyi, is recognized as a monument of architecture, urban planning, and local historical significance.

Before the full-scale Russian invasion, the Myklashevskyi Estate was included in several tourist routes of the Zaporizhzhia region, developed by local historians.

Damage to historic buildings during hostilities highlights the urgent need for protection and documentation of Ukraine's cultural heritage even in times of war.
